Recovered Deleted files - files now have ~pstmp extension

We have an emergency situation at work.  We had some mass file deletions of some really important files.  I scanned the backup drive with some different "undelete" programs, and I see all the files there.  The problem is they are all tagged with ~pstmp at the end.  For instance - Q4_Sales_Goals.xls.~pstmp     This is the same for all types of documents.   I tried just changing the extension, but the file still wont open.

Any ideas?

The files were from our PeerSync backup program.  I ended up using a mass file renamer, and changing all the extensions, then opening each item individually to see if they were corrupt.  We recovered roughly 90%.  Thanks for the help!
